Title: Housing Inventory: Active Listing Count in Stevens Point, WI (CBSA) Series ID: ACTLISCOU44620 Source: Realtor.com Release: Housing Inventory Core Metrics Seasonal Adjustment: Not Seasonally Adjusted Frequency: Monthly Units: Level Date Range: 2016-07-01 to 2024-04-01 Last Updated: 2024-05-02 5:13 PM CDT Notes: The count of active single-family and condo/townhome listings for a given market during the specified month (excludes pending listings). With the release of its September 2022 housing trends report, Realtor.com® incorporated a new and improved methodology for capturing and reporting housing inventory trends and metrics. The new methodology updates and improves the calculation of time on market and improves handling of duplicate listings. Most areas across the country will see minor changes with a smaller handful of areas seeing larger updates. As a result of these changes, the data released since October 2022 will not be directly comparable with previous data releases (files downloaded before October 2022) and Realtor.com® economics blog posts. However, future data releases, including historical data, will consistently apply the new methodology.
